WebMar 5, 2024 · Draping of the saree: They start wearing the saree from the pallu called ‘Padar’. The pallu is pleated which covers the widthwise and kept on the left shoulder. Rest of the saree is then draped and made into pleats and tucked securely for Kashti. The Brahmin ladies divide pleats into unequal parts, less on the left side and more on the right. WebShantipuri cotton saree find its place in traditional fabrics of West Bengal due to its elegant look, elaborated design details and typical loom finish. Hank sizing using indegenous ingredients like puffed paddy (khoi), boiled rice, sagoo etc. for both warp and weft is practised in Shantipuri saree weaving. WebSep 26, 2016 · Mirpur is a suburb in Dhaka where Bangladesh’s largest Banarasi manufacturing and selling occurs. The area is called ‘Mirpur Banarasi Palli’. More than 20,000 looms were in production in the area. But at present only about 5000 looms are there and less than 3500 are in production. Generally the number of artisans is equal to the …
